We are accepting applications for two full-time Parks Labourer Students to join our Parks team for a four-month term, starting in May 2026. The Parks Labourer Student performs a variety of outdoor activities including, but not limited to, the operation and maintenance of the CVRD’s parks and trails and helping to educate the public on park rules. Reporting to the Senior Parks Technician, the primary responsibilities of this role include:

  • Performing a variety of general labour activities including garbage pick-up, sweeping, removing invasive species, cleaning, painting, shoveling and other labour-related tasks within the CVRD parks;
  • Operating various light trucks, small equipment and hand tools;
  • Constructing and maintaining trails in park settings;
  • Carrying out safe work practices, reporting unsafe situations and implementing emergency procedures as directed;
  • Interacting with and educating the public on the regional district’s bylaws pertaining to parks;
  • Assisting with routine maintenance in all parks as required.

Our ideal candidate is:

  • Comfortable working in an outdoor, wilderness environment in all-weather conditions, operating small equipment and interacting with the public, with over six months up to one year of directly related experience and a minimum of Grade 12 (or equivalent);
  • Certified in Emergency First Aid (Occupational First Aid Level 1 is an asset);
  • Courteous and tactful with the ability to relate effectively with the general public, contractors, volunteers and coworkers;
  • Team-oriented with strong interpersonal skills;
  • Safety-conscious with a demonstrated commitment to safe work practices;
  • Comfortable using hand tools, working in awkward positions, standing and walking throughout the day and performing heavy manual work as required.

The hours of work for these positions will be 8:30 am to 4:30 pm, Monday through Friday with occasional weekend work as needed. A valid BC Class 5 driver’s license is required for this role. Successful candidates will be required to consent to a Canadian Criminal Record Check.

NOTE: Applicants must be returning to an educational institution upon completion of employment to be eligible for this opportunity.
